Python !!install!! Download Ftp Review

If you need to grab everything in a folder, use nlst() to get a list of filenames and loop through them.

The core method for downloading binary files (like images, ZIPs, or PDFs) is retrbinary() . This command requests the file from the server and writes it to a local file on your machine. Code Example: python download ftp

: By default, data is transferred in 8KB blocks, but you can adjust this using the blocksize parameter for large files. 3. Downloading All Files in a Directory If you need to grab everything in a